Objective To verify that combined detection of P53 protein and tumor markers in serum was better than any single marker detection on auxiliary diagnosis of the distant metastasis of digestive malignant neoplasm.Methods There were 55 post-operation patients with digestive malignant neoplasm diagnosed by pathology,all the cases were divided into metastasis group(19 cases with distant metastasis) and non-metastasis group(36 cases without distant metastasis),in addition to 14 healthy volunteers.We detected P53 protein and CEA,CA19-9,CA242,CA72-4 in serum by ELISA.Results The P53 level in serum in metastasis group were higher than that in non-metastasis group(P0.05),which in metastasis group and non-metastasis group were both higher than that in healthy control group(P0.05).P53,CA19-9,CA72-4 were risk factors of the distant metastasis of digestive malignant neoplasm.Applying the three to diagnose the distant metastasis of digestive malignant neoplasm,the sensitivities were respectively 84.2%,73.7%,47.4%,the specificities were respectively 100%,77.8%,97.2%.For parallel test of P53 and CA19-9,the sensitivity was 100.0%,the specificity was 61.1%.Conclusion P53 is a valuable single marker for auxiliary diagnosis of the distant metastasis of digestive malignant neoplasm.When P53 protein in serum is higher than 0.4086U/ml,it can be used to auxiliaryly positively diagnose the distant metastasis of digestive malignant neoplasm.When P53 and CA19-9 are both negative,it can be used to auxiliaryly deny the distant metastasis of digestive malignant neoplasm.
